Considerations Before Installation

Before working with a sliding door installer, it's vital to consider numerous factors:

  1. Material: Sliding doors can be found in a range of products, including wood, fiberglass, and vinyl. The choice of product impacts resilience, upkeep, and aesthetic appeals.

  2. Size: Measure the installation area properly. Professional installers typically have tools to ensure accurate measurements.

  3. Glazing: Consider whether you want double or triple glazing for better insulation.

  4. Modification: Many sliding doors can be tailored in terms of color, surface, and design. Talking about these options with the installer will ensure fulfillment.

  5. Laws: Check local building regulations and regulations that might refer to sliding door installations.

The Installation Process

Working with a professional involves a number of steps to guarantee a smooth installation procedure. Here's a summary of what to expect:

  1. Consultation and Estimate:

    • The installer sees your home to examine the installation location.
    • Discuss your preferences and budget plan.
    • The installer offers a price quote based on your requirements.
  2. Preparation:

    • The installer prepares the area by removing any existing components and ensuring a tidy work environment.
    • This might consist of eliminating old doors, repairing surrounding frames, or developing an assistance structure.
  3. Installation:

    • The sliding door frame is put together and protected into the prepared opening.
    • Unique attention is paid to leveling and positioning to ensure the door operates efficiently.
    • Additional sealing and insulation measures are implemented to enhance energy efficiency.
  4. Finishing Touches:

    • Final adjustments are made to the sliding door system.
    • The installer might use any necessary weather condition stripping and clean the workspace.
  5. Post-Installation Checks:

    • The installer will evaluate the door's performance and make any last-minute modifications, making sure that it satisfies quality standards.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)

  1. What is the average lifespan of a sliding door?

    • Sliding doors normally last in between 20 to 30 years, depending upon the product and upkeep.
  2. Can I set up a sliding door myself?

    • While DIY installation is possible, working with professionals assurances better results and minimizes the risk of mistakes.
  3. What maintenance do sliding doors need?

    • Regular cleansing, lubrication of the tracks, and checking seals for wear and tear are necessary for upkeep.
  4. What should I think about when picking a sliding door?

    • Examine your requirements in terms of area, insulation, design, and budget plan before choosing.
  5. Are sliding doors energy effective?

    • Modern sliding doors, especially those with double or triple glazing, can provide considerable energy effectiveness.
